3,691 Steps to Miles, By Height

The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 3,691 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.

HeightDistance
Short (~5'2")1.50 mi
Average (~5'7")1.62 mi
Tall (~6'2")1.78 mi

Where 3,691 Steps Ranks

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 3,691 steps falls.

Activity LevelDaily Steps
SedentaryUnder 5,000
Low Active5,000–7,499
Somewhat Active7,500–9,999
Active10,000–12,499
Highly Active12,500+

Did You Know?

1

Step counters can undercount you if you're pushing a stroller or shopping cart, a lot of them lean on arm-swing motion, not just leg movement, to detect a step. Wrist placement versus pocket placement can shift the count too.

2

The record for farthest distance walked in 24 hours, set by Jesse Castenda in 1976, is about 142 miles, somewhere north of 280,000 steps in a single day without stopping.
